Abstract
The invention relates to a series-connected hopper wheel type system for automatically discharging and vertically continuously delivering materials, which mainly comprises a feeding pipeline, a material feeding system and bottom automatic discharging type hoppers. The feeding pipeline is vertically arranged to the underground from the ground and comprises a feeding pipe and a hopper-lifting pipe; a hopper laying-down guide rail is arranged in the feeding pipe; an automatic discharging guide rail is arranged at the lower part of an inner wall of the feeding pipeline; the material feeding system comprises a drive wheel, a reverse wheel and a flexible traction chain, wherein the flexible traction chain is arranged between the two wheels and is transmitted through contact engagement with sawteeth at edges of the two wheels. The bottom automatic discharging type hoppers are connected in series to the flexible traction chain in an equal distance; the materials are loaded into the bottom automatic discharging type hopper from a feeding port of a trumpet-shaped upper end port of the feeding pipe and are transported to the underground along with the rotation of the flexible traction chain. The invention solves the problems of continuous feeding and automatic discharging of the materials, and realizes that the materials are continuously and effectively delivered to the underground from the ground. The system is simple in structure and is easy to realize.

Technical field
The present invention relates to the wheeled automatic discharging vertical continuous convey materials of a kind of series connection hopper system, especially a kind of the ground solid material is transported to the down-hole, be used for the material jettison system of colliery and metal mine filling mining.
Background technology
Continuous development along with China's railways and water-bodies technology, with spoil, fly ash, loess, solid materials such as building waste are that the comprehensive mechanization solid material filling coal mining technology of compaction material is ripe day by day, it has realized the scale exploitation of " three times " pressure coal and metal mine, and the goaf carried out effective filling, reached the resource recovery rate effect that improves coal and metal mine, solved the solid waste spoil simultaneously, fly ash, the ground stacking of metal tailings is handled problems, and comprehensive mechanization solid material filling coal mining technology has important practical significance and wide application prospect.But how with solid material safety, be transported to apart from ground hundreds of rice from ground efficiently, economically and even go up the dark down-hole of km and carry out the bottleneck that goaf filling is the technical development of comprehensive mechanization solid material filling coal mining, be a great problem that current urgent need solves.
